Or. Admin. R. 461-140-0010 - Assets; Income and Resources
(1)
An available asset, either income or a resource, is categorized as either
excluded or countable (defined in OAR 461-001-0000).
(2) The availability of resources is covered
in OAR 461-140-0020.
(3) The
availability of income is covered in OAR 461-140-0040.
(4) Excluded assets are identified in the
rules in this chapter (see divisions 140 and 145 in particular) and are not
considered when a client's eligibility and benefit level are determined.
(5) In the OSIP, OSIPM, and QMB
programs, an asset excluded pursuant to a rule in OAR Chapter 461 remains
excluded as long as the asset is used in a manner consistent with the rule that
provided the exclusion.
(6) An
available asset not specifically excluded is countable, and its value is used
in determining the eligibility and benefit level of a client.
(7) An asset may not be counted as a resource
and as income in the same month.
